La Casa Castro, S.A. De C.V. v. Greenberg Traurig, P.A.

992 So. 2d 974, 2008 La. LEXIS 1854, 2008 WL 4758859
Supreme Court of Louisiana·Decided September 26, 2008·No. No. 2008-CC-1394·Published

Opinion

In re Greenberg Traurig P.A. et al.; Martinez, Roberto; Martinez-Fraga, Pedro J.; — Defendant(s); Applying for Supervisory and/or Remedial Writs, Parish of Orleans, Civil District Court Div. E, No. 2004-17132; to the Court of Appeal, Fourth Circuit, No. 2008-C-0240.

Granted. The case is remanded to the court of appeal, which is instructed to allow relator to supplement its application with the appropriate documentation and to consider the application, as supplemented, on the merits.
